Styling products are extremely necessary and useful to succeed in making a simple hairstyle, we can get volume or smoothness, protection, gloss, and last but not least the durability of the shape, the hairstyle we have achieved. There is a wide variety of products on the market and it can be quite difficult to decide what suits you - it would be ideal to consult your stylist who is best able to recommend exactly what you need, . The products are generally divided according to the benefit they offer, namely fastening, volume, gloss, smoothing and moisturizing, soothing the rebels, etc. . It is important, therefore, to know from the very beginning what we need as a goal, to know what product to choose. About the most useful styling products, from how we choose them and how to apply them correctly, explains Arabella Zadic, senior trainer The Studio and Ambassador System Professional and GHD Romania.

Here are 10 of the most used / useful styling products 1. Fixative It is the most popular and indispensable product in a hairdressing salon, especially it is usually found in 3 forms (weak, medium, strong). This product is designed to maintain the final shape of the hairstyle, according to its fastening power. How to apply the fixative correctly: The fixative applies to FINAL on dry hair after the hairstyle (whether it is a simple haircut, a tail, a hair, etc. ), from a distance of 10-15 cm, .

If it is applied from a very small distance, near the scalp and hair, the hair will moisten and the hairs will stick strongly, resulting in an unpleasant aspect that the hair will suffer. How to choose the fixative: Attention also when choosing the fastening power, while working a hairdo, always choose a weak fixative, as the stylists say, so that it can easily be removed if a suede has not been placed correctly . Instead, in the end, you can use a fixative with medium fixation, knowing that we will not make any changes to the hairstyle. Strong fixation fixatives are usually used by stylists when creating more extravagant looks, perhaps even competition, or the customer's desire is to have maximum hairstyle durability. Also, it is recommended that a weaker fixative be applied to a thinner thread, while stronger hair, with the thicker thread, can support a stronger fixative.

2. Styling Foam A product pretty much used by ladies / brides who have a thinner, hairless hair. Really foam, it generally offers volume, but it is recommended to be used with a medium to thick thread (Natural Volume from EIMI). For a thin yarn, it is recommended to use a more light-weight, less moisturizing treatment that does not load the hair. How to apply styling foam: And this product contains varying degrees of fixation, analogous to fixative, but this time applied to freshly washed hair and moistened lightly with the towel.

Apply a medium amount (as a tennis ball) for a hair to shoulder, with medium thickness, lengths and peaks, it is well balanced, then the hair is coiffed. Offers a great base for any hairstyle (coco, textures). Avoid high amounts and apply on dry hair - the hair will stick and will not be molded anymore. 3. Dry Shampoo It is extremely useful, especially if we take into consideration the time crisis that we all complain about, but be careful not to abuse this product. How to apply dry shampoo: It is thought to be applied by spraying on the scalp to absorb sebum and impurities (Dry Me EIMI), and so we can extend the hair wash rate by one day, but no more.

Using it too often, or too much, excessive, it can have side effects (it collides at the root of the hair that will fall). In other words, we only use it if we are gone somewhere, we do not have a shampoo and we can extend one day when we wash our head - we spray it mainly on the top, on the path, from a distance. If we see a white powder, it is the starch that has the role of absorbing sebum, it can be removed by combing. 7. Textured matte paste A product genre that has more history in hair care for men, because they have a matte look, has gained ground but also in the area is feminine hairstyle, especially if we talk about a textured haircut, length .

How To Apply: Extremely easy to use, always apply to dry hair, finally, by massaging a very small amount of product (as a bean) in the palm of your hands, then spread over your palm (including fingers) . Avoid large quantities, let's start with a little bit of product and then add, rather than put it first and find that we need to wash our head again. Provides modeling, texture and a matte look. 8. Hair Gel It is a well-known product that offers a medium degree of grip and gloss, smooths the area on which this product is applied.

It is usually used on certain areas of focus to obtain an extremely smooth and glossy surface, or when a horse tail is caught and the hair is blunt, short haircuts, medium. It is especially recommended if the hair is thick and the hair thick, because the hair will stick strongly to each other and then the hair will seem half less often than it is - a result that is not wanted by thin-wired people. How to apply the hair gel: Apply the same as the matte paste, on dry hair, a small amount and massage on the desired area. Ideally, this gel will not have too much fixation power and may let the hair reshape like a paste (Gel Forte from Sebastian). 9.
